OZYWALKER XR50T Legacy Donating Member 2,795 Member For: 13y 4m 16d Gender: Male Location: Western Sydney Posted 24/10/16 11:09 PM Posted 24/10/16 11:09 PM Cheapest way to drop the rear is to swap the overload leafs onto the top of the spring pack, that will drop it around 40mm.Fronts, lower coils for you budget, I would get some half decent shocks if you can stretch the budget.
